
Shot Heard 'Round the World is a fascinating dive into a moment that defines baseball lore. It’s not just about the home run itself; it captures the intense rivalry between the Giants and Dodgers, the personalities on and off the field, and the palpable tension of that era. The pacing is deliberate, allowing you to soak in the atmosphere of 1950s baseball culture. The interviews and archival footage blend seamlessly, really pulling you into the emotional weight of Thomson's swing. It's a documentary that, while focused on a single event, manages to convey the broader themes of competition, legacy, and the human experience in sports.
